Quantum Lab guided tour at Fraunhofer

Image
  ๐Ÿ’ฌ Many of us assume our WhatsApp messages are completely safe because they’re protected by end-to-end encryption. But this is not quite true! ⚛️ Last week, I had the chance to join a guided tour at the Fraunhofer Institute for Industrial Engineering IAO "Quantum Lab". While AI continues to dominate headlines, researchers are already working on the next potentially world-changing technology: Quantum computing. ๐Ÿ’ก One of the mind-blowing characteristics of quantum computers is that they can solve certain mathematical problems much faster than today’s computers. This is important to know, because many of the #encryption methods we rely on today – including those used to secure WhatsApp messages – are based on mathematical problems that are extremely difficult for current computers to solve. ❗ Quantum computers could change that. โ„น️ This means that your messages are safe today, but once quantum computers mature, they may be able to break today’s encryption standards far ...
